    Required Skills/Experience:

    • Must have unit/specialty experience in the past 6 months.
    • Requires strong proficiency in advanced EUS, complex ERCP and stent placement/exchange/removal and stone management
    • Endo techs need solid, meticulous manual scope washing and handling skills, HLD skills in Medivator DSD Edge and Olympus OER Pro, proficient and independent general GI skills for biopsy, snare, GI bleed, injections, lifting agents, banding, dilation with balloon or savory/Maloney dilators.

    Preferred Skills/Experience: Advanced skills for EBUS, ION

    Required Credentials: Resume: Each employment history entry must include all the following: detailed duties, hospital size, unit size, trauma level (if applicable), patient ratio, teaching facility.

    Shift & Scheduling:

    • They flex start and end times according to case volumes
    • Endo Techs share weeknight call coverage (typically 2 nights/wk.) and rotate weekend call coverage as well.
    • Holiday/Call Requirements: Shared weekend/holiday call
    • What is call response time? 30 minutes

    Ambulatory Care Travel Job Responsibilities

    Ambulatory Care healthcare professionals, including Ambulatory Care Nurses and Allied Health Professionals, work in settings that offer diagnostic testing and provide primary and specialty care for patients. Their responsibilities encompass assessment, care delivery, and care coordination across the lifespan. Whether interacting with patients face-to-face or through telehealth, Ambulatory Care professionals ensure high-quality care delivery.     Ambulatory Care Travel Allied Jobs in Arizona

    Ambulatory Care offers a diverse range of travel job opportunities for both nursing and allied health professionals. As healthcare continues to shift towards outpatient settings, Ambulatory Care professionals play a vital role in delivering care outside traditional inpatient facilities. Practice locations include private or group medical practices, clinics in hospitals or educational organizations, patients' homes, and diagnostic procedure centers. With the increasing demand for telehealth services, Ambulatory Care professionals may also provide virtual care. Critical thinking skills, patient education, advocacy, and care coordination are key aspects of this specialty.
